I am running a new Red Sea Nano Max with LIFE rock and live sand. Carbon and Floss is all that is in the back sump other than the non running skinner.
I started the tank with Fritz Turbo 900 at the recommended amount for 20gallons which I believe was 2 caps of the stuff. I added 2 tiny clowns at the same time. I feed flakes.
I have 8.0 PH, .25 Ammonia (possibly false), 0 Nitrite, 0 Nitrate. Water is super clean and nothing growing. I did add some Prime just in case with the ammonia but the clowns are just fine.
My question is should the parameters be changing? I have had these sane readings for the last 10 days. I have not done a water change and can’t honestly tell if anything is happening for the cycle or if anything is gonna happen. I know it’s early but I thought there would be something happening in the water....
